Council unanimously supports funds for upgrade to Wilson Park netball courts

City of Belmont Councillors unanimously voted at the 23 February, 2021 Ordinary Council Meeting to commit nearly a million dollars towards upgrading the netball courts at Wilson Park.

The total estimated cost for the facility upgrade is $1,539,000 Million and involves the removal and reconstruction of the existing courts and installation of new lighting towers.

“Our commitment follows the City’s successful application to the State Government’s Community Sporting and Recreation Facilities Fund, where we were granted $513,000 towards the cost of the project,” City of Belmont Mayor Cr Phil Marks said.

“The upgrade to this much loved sporting facility will ensure the community continues to have access to the services and facilities it needs, while also supporting the Belmont Netball Association’s objectives to provide improved infrastructure for current and new users, in order to increase membership and participation,” Mayor Marks said.

“I commend the efforts of the board and members of Belmont Netball Association who have committed to contributing $100,000 towards this renewal project as well,” he said.

“This is a significant commitment to our youth, and the wellbeing of the City’s residents demonstrating Council’s understanding of the needs of our community. I am looking forward to seeing the progression of this project.”

With the aim of commencing the project in late 2021, Council’s decision has now approved the inclusion of $926,000 in the 2021-2022 Annual Budget for the facility upgrade.
